Simple Steps for importing Sony a7s AVCHD files into Sony Movie Studio 13

Step 1. Import MTS to the converter

Run the MTS to Sony Movie Studio converter and click the Add Files button to import the MTS videos to be converted. The converter supports converting multiple files at a time.



Step 2. Choose target format

Hit the "Format" bar and select Adobe Premiere/Sony Vegas > MPEG-2 (*.mpg) as output format on the drop-down menu.



Tip: In case the default settings do not fit your requirement, you can click "Settings" button and enter "Profile Settings" panel to adjust video size, bit rate, frame rate, sample rate and audio channels.

Step 3. Start MTS conversion with a click

Simply click the "Convert" button to start converting MTS for Sony Movie Studio and everything else will be automated.

After the process completes, click "Open" button to find the generated videos. Now, it's much easy for you to import Sony a7s AVCHD files to Sony Movie Studio 10/11/12/13 for further editing.
